Chimney Tuna Loin

  • Level: Easy
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Total: 13 min
  • Prep: 10 min
  • Cook: 3 min

Ingredients

1/2 cup dark soy sauce

1/2 cup honey

1/4 cup dry wasabi powder

2 pounds tuna loin, cut into 2 pieces

1/2 cup sesame seeds

2 tablespoons peanut oil

Directions

  1. In a non-reactive bowl combine soy, honey, and wasabi powder. Reserve 1/4 cup for dipping sauce. Roll each piece of tuna in this mixture to coat evenly. Marinate from 1 hour to overnight. Remove the tuna from the marinade and discard the marinade.
  2. On a plate, lay the sesame seeds. Roll the tuna in the seeds to evenly coat.
  3. Fire up the chimney and top with a well-oiled grate. Sear for 15 to 30 seconds per side or to desired temperature. Remove to rack and rest for 3 minutes. Cover with foil or plastic wrap to achieve carry over cooking. Slice thinly and serve with the dipping sauce.
